# //ui/base This directory contains low-level code that is reused throughout the chromium UI stack. Code in this directory can't depend on most of the rest of //ui (with a few exceptions), and code throughout the rest of //ui can depend on it. Toolkit-specific libraries in this directory include: * [cocoa](cocoa): for working with Cocoa on macOS * [wayland](wayland): for Linux systems with Wayland * [webui](webui): for WebUI in Chromium * [win](win): for Windows systems * [x](x): for Linux systems with X11 Platform-independent libraries in this directory include: * [l10n](l10n): localization APIs used throughout all of chromium, especially the widely-used `l10n_util::GetString*` functions * [metadata](metadata): the implementation of the property/metadata system used throughout [views] * [models](models): toolkit-agnostic types used to represent the data shown in UI controls and dialogs * [resource](resource): resource bundle APIs, which are used for retrieving icons and raw localized strings from the app package As with most "base" libraries this is somewhat of a dumping ground of code that is used in a bunch of other places, and there's no hard and fast rule to tell what should or shouldn't be in here.
